CLEFT has 2 great aims: to support sustainable and multidisciplinary cleft care in lower and middle income countries (surgery is important but only part of the journey), and to support research into the causes and provision of cleft care in the UK. Our new film shines a light on the twinning relationship, developed between Newcastle’s Royal Victoria Infirmary and the Kirtipur Hospital in Kathmandu, Nepal. Filmed by Prasuna Dongol, a Nepalese film maker based in Kathmandu herself, and edited by Paul Whittaker, this is a fascinating insight into how different cleft disciplines can work together to provide a more holistic approach to treatment.
